Amanda Easton is a soulful pop, rock and jazz artist whose vivacious personality and rich soaring vocals capture her audience and take them on a musical tour of love and laughter. A very versatile entertainer, she performs a wide crowd-pleasing repertoire as a front person in various shows, as a seasoned backing vocalist and as a soloist vocalist and piano player.

A 2015 Mo Award Nominee, she has performed in prestigious venues throughout Australia from the Sydney Entertainment Centre to 5 Star Hotels, major clubs, Royal Caribbean’s ‘Radiance of the Seas’ cruise ship and regular appearances at the iconic Basement at Circular Quay and at the Taronga Zoo Twilight Series. She has also done stints in Japan, Bali, Malaysia, Noumea as well as toured throughout Europe. She performs regularly in popular production shows including ‘Rumours’, ‘Classic Kings Rocking the 70s’, and ‘First Ladies of Soul’, and produces and performs in ‘The Swell Sisters’. She also produced and starred in three sold-out shows at the Sydney Opera House.

She has performed for the who's who of Australian corporations, at the ACE Awards and twice at the ARIA Awards. She's appeared onstage as backing vocalist for some of Australia's best loved musical legends including Glenn Shorrock, Powderfinger, Marcia Hines, James Reyne and Vanessa Amarosi and has been on national and international tours with multi-platinum artists Richard Clapton and Wendy Matthews.

Amanda has also lent her voice as a lead and backing vocalist to many other artists' and commercial recording projects including TV Commercials and international DJ releases. She co-writes for various local and international artists as well as herself, with a recent single ‘The New Bohemians’ being nominated for an Australian Songwriting Award. She has had five commercial releases of her own, with two of her singles appearing in the top 10 of the independent Aussie charts. Her music videos and live performances have often graced Aussie television screens including 'MTV' and ‘The Morning Show’.

Amanda has hosted and produced music shows on 2SER, 2MCR and 2MCE radio stations as well as produced and hosted her own 13 Episode Television Series showcasing female singers called 'PopTarts' for TVS in Sydney and Channel 31 in Melbourne.
